All the ancient greeks in your own words "believe in what they
understand, not necessarily in what they observe" and that was the
problem. Aristotle believed that heavy objects fell more
quickly than light ones, something that could have been easily
disproved even on his own day but he understood it so well, or
thought he did, that he didn't bother to make any observations on
the matter. In the same way Aristotle "understood" that women had
fewer teeth than men so he never thought it necessary to actually
count the teeth in his wife's mouth even though he was married
twice. And that sort of thinking is exactly why science made such
little progress for 2000 years, from the ancient Greeks to the
renaissance.
